Analysis
The most recent figure for out-of-school rate for children and adolescents of primary and lower in Lesotho is 33.5%, measured in 2024.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 3.1% on the previous year and up 91.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, out-of-school rate for children and adolescents of primary and lower in Lesotho peaked at 52.0% in 1973 and was at its lowest, 16.3%, in 2006.
That places Lesotho 13th out of 169 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the top 10%.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 43 years of available data.

Lesotho compared with similar countries
- Lesotho's 33.5% is above the median for lower middle income countries, which is 9.7%, 3.4× the median. (37 countries reporting)
- Lesotho's 33.5% is above the median for Sub-Saharan Africa, which is 20.5%, 1.6× the median. (35 countries reporting)
